The Evolution and Revival of the Cross-Collared Hanfu:Traditional Chinese Elegance

In the tapestry of Chinese cultural heritage, the cross-collared汉服 (Hanfu) stands as a testament to the nation's profound history and aesthetics. This traditional clothing, originating from the Han dynasty, encapsulates the essence of ancient Chinese fashion and societal norms. The intricate design of the cross collar, also known as "Yongjin", symbolizes balance, harmony, and dignity.

The cross-collared Hanfu is not just a piece of clothing; it's an embodiment of cultural continuity and pride. It has experienced several transformations throughout history, adapting to different eras and styles, yet always maintaining its core elements of elegance and simplicity. From the Song dynasty's more relaxed and casual styles to the Ming dynasty's intricate embroidery and luxurious designs, the cross-collared Hanfu has always been a reflection of its wearer's status, values, and cultural identity.

In recent years, there has been a revival of interest in traditional Chinese culture, and the cross-collared Hanfu has been at the forefront of this revival. Modern enthusiasts, known as "Hanfu enthusiasts," are embracing this traditional clothing as a way to connect with their cultural roots and promote Chinese heritage. The cross-collared Hanfu has become a symbol of cultural identity and pride for many Chinese people, regardless of age or generation.

The beauty of the cross-collared Hanfu lies in its simplicity and versatility. The clean lines and classic designs can be paired with modern elements, creating a seamless blend of old and new. The Hanfu has also been adapted to be worn in various occasions, from formal events to everyday wear, demonstrating its adaptability and relevance in modern society.
